#db162c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#db162c is composed of 85.9% red, 8.6%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90% magenta, 79.9%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 353.3 degrees, a saturation of 81.7% and a lightness of 47.3%. #db162c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2c58 with #b70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#db162c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#db162c has RGB values of R:219, G:22, B:44 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.9, Y:0.8,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 14358060.
